2. User-Generated Content, Responsibility & Platform Immunity

2.1 Platform as an Intermediary

Yeet is an “intermediary” within the meaning of Section 2(1)(w) of the Information Technology Act, 2000 (“IT Act”). Under Section 79 of the IT Act, Yeet shall not be liable for any third-party information, data, or communication link made available or hosted on the Platform, provided Yeet observes due diligence and complies with applicable law and these Terms.

Yeet’s role is strictly limited to providing a neutral technological platform that enables users to create, upload, and share short-form video expressing thoughts, opinions, debates, and discussions. Yeet does not:

  • initiate or modify the transmission of any content or data;
  • select the recipient of any transmission made by users; or
  • alter, edit, moderate, or curate any user-generated content in any manner.

Accordingly, Yeet:

  • is not responsible or liable for user-generated content;
  • does not endorse, verify, or vouch for the accuracy, legality, morality, or completeness of any statement, opinion, or representation made by users; and
  • is not responsible or liable for any consequence, damage, loss, or claim arising from user content, including but not limited to defamation, infringement of intellectual-property rights, obscenity, hate speech, or privacy violations.

3.2 Prohibited Content (as per Rule 3(1)(b), IT Rules 2021)

You are strictly prohibited from uploading, posting, transmitting, or sharing any Content that:

  • Belongs to another person without authorization;
  • Is defamatory, obscene, pornographic, paedophilic, invasive of privacy, or otherwise objectionable;
  • Insults or harasses on the basis of gender, religion, caste, sexual orientation, race, disability, or similar grounds;
  • Exploits, abuses, sexualizes, harms, or endangers minors in any manner, including child sexual abuse material (CSAM), sexual exploitation of children, or any content involving the nudity, abuse, or endangerment of minors;
  • Infringes any intellectual-property right (copyright, trademark, patent etc.) without permission;
  • Deceives or misleads as to origin or communicates false or misleading information;
  • Impersonates another person or organisation;
  • Threatens the unity, integrity, defence, security, or sovereignty of India, friendly relations with foreign states, or public order;
  • Incites an offence or promotes criminal, immoral, or unlawful activity;
  • Is patently false, untrue, or misleading and likely to cause harm to individuals or society;
  • Violates any law or contains viruses, malware, or malicious code;
  • Promotes gambling, narcotics, weapons, counterfeit goods, or other illegal products; or
  • Involves unauthorised solicitation or spam, including chain letters, pyramid schemes, or bulk marketing.

Any violation shall lead to immediate removal of content, permanent account termination, and reporting to authorities, without any liability or obligation on Yeet or Sarnav Technologies.

6.5. Copyright Infringement Notice (DMCA / Indian Copyright Procedure)

If you believe that your copyrighted material has been used or shared on Yeet without authorization, you may submit a written complaint to our Copyright Officer containing:

  • Your full name, address, and contact details;;
  • Identification of the copyrighted work claimed to have been infringed;
  • A clear description or URL of the allegedly infringing content;
  • A statement that you are the copyright owner or authorized agent; and
  • A statement that you are the copyright owner or authorized agent; and

support@yeet.co.in

(This is the sole official address for copyright claims under the Indian Copyright Act, 1957. Yeet does not accept physical correspondence. Address div may be provided via email upon lawful request.)

Upon receiving a valid notice, Yeet will act in accordance with the Copyright Act, 1957 (Section 52(1)(c)) and remove or disable the content within a reasonable timeframe.

8.4 Data Storage and Retention

Data is stored on secure servers located in India or in jurisdictions providing adequate data protection.

Personal data is retained only for as long as necessary to provide services, fulfill legal or regulatory obligations, or resolve disputes (minimum 180 days after deletion, as required under the IT Rules 2021).

Residual data may persist temporarily in backups or logs for audit and security purposes.

Yeet shall not be liable for the presence of such residual data retained under technical or legal necessity.

8.5 Data Security Practices

Yeet adheres to the Reasonable Security Practices and Procedures framework under Rule 8 of the IT (Sensitive Personal Data or Information) Rules, 2011, including:

  • Encryption (in transit and at rest);
  • Secure server environments and firewalls;
  • Role-based access control and monitoring;
  • Periodic security audits and vulnerability testing; an
  • Confidentiality obligations for all staff and vendors.

No digital system is completely secure. You acknowledge that use of Yeet is at your own risk.

Yeet, its affiliates, and employees shall not be liable for any breach, unauthorized access, or data compromise caused by hacking, malware, phishing, fraudulent activity, user negligence, or force majeure events beyond its control.
